“Once two men a 'Sean-Bheist' and a 'Carabhat' had a fight.”
Once two men a "Sean-Bhiest" and a "Carabhat" had a fight. After a while the former, was winning. When had knocked the "Carabhat" he began to kick him. To kill him right he hit him on the head with a big stone. The names of those two men were I think Philip O'Meana and a man named Butler.- Collector
